GAME 1 – LOUISIANA 14, GEORGIA STATE 1 (7 innings)
Herrmann (6-2) scattered five hits and fanned six batters in recording his fourth complete game of the season and moving into a tie for the national lead with Jaden Wywoda of Holy Cross. The southpaw kept GSU off the board until the seventh when Wesley Bass hit a solo homer to help the Panthers avoid a shutout.
Louisiana took a 3-0 lead in the second inning, beginning with Brown's fourth home run of the the season off GSU starter Brian Crooms (3-4) – a 411-foot blast to center. The Ragin' Cajuns added two more runs in the frame when Drew Markle lifted a sacrifice fly to drive in Blaze Rodriguez before Steven Spalitta slid in under the tag of Panther's catcher Lucas Grantham on a double steal.
The Ragin' Cajuns scored seven runs in the third as Brown drove in Lee Amedee with a bloop single to left for a 4-0 lead. Spalitta added an RBI single to plate Rigoberto Hernandez and Brown scored on a balk before Markle hit an RBI double into the left-center field gap.
Amedee drew a bases-loaded walk for an 8-0 lead before a wild throw on a pickoff led to runs by Mark Collins and Lewis.
LaSalle increased Louisiana's lead to 13-0 in the fourth after plastering a 0-and-1 pitch for his eighth homer of the season - a three-run, 424-foot drive to left.
The Cajuns added their final run in the fifth as Lewis scored on a fielding error.
Crooms allowed four runs on a pair of hits in 2.0 innings of work. Bass went 2-for-3 for the Panthers with Austin Killingworth and Cole Griffith each adding doubles.
